Popup & Download Permissions: Why Are They Forced?

by SLV Team 51 views
Popup & Download Permissions: Why are they Forced?

Hey everyone! Let's dive into a pretty important discussion about popup and automatic download permissions. It seems some users are curious, and rightfully so, about why these settings were forcibly enabled and, more importantly, why they can't be disabled. We'll also tackle the question of why automatic file downloads to client devices are necessary. So, let's get started and break it all down.

Understanding the Concerns Around Forced Permissions

When popup and automatic download settings are forcibly enabled, it's natural to feel a bit uneasy. Your first thought might be, "Why is this happening?" or "Is my system at risk?" These are valid concerns, especially in today's digital landscape where privacy and security are paramount. We need to address these concerns head-on and understand the reasons behind such decisions. Often, developers implement these measures with specific intentions, but without clear communication, it can lead to confusion and mistrust. Think of it like this: if a new rule suddenly appeared in your favorite game without explanation, you'd probably want to know why, right? Similarly, understanding the rationale behind these technical changes is crucial for everyone involved.

Why Are Popups and Automatic Downloads Enabled?

The reasons for enabling popups and automatic downloads can vary, but they often boil down to a few key factors. One primary reason is communication. Imagine needing to inform users about critical updates, changes, or important announcements. Popups can be an effective way to ensure that everyone sees the message, rather than relying on users to check a settings window or an obscure notification. Another reason might be functionality. Some applications or extensions require the ability to download files automatically to function correctly. This could be for installing updates, downloading necessary components, or even for saving user data. However, the crucial point here is transparency. If these features are enabled, users deserve a clear explanation of why and what benefits they offer. This helps to build trust and ensures that everyone is on the same page.

The Importance of User Control and Disabling Options

Now, let's talk about control. The internet is a space where users value the ability to customize their experience. Being able to disable popup and automatic download settings is a big part of that. Why? Because it puts the power back in the hands of the user. If someone doesn't want to see popups or prefers to manually manage downloads, they should have the option to do so. Forcibly enabling these features can feel intrusive and can lead to frustration. It's like being told you have to watch a specific TV channel—even if you're not interested. Providing the option to disable these settings shows respect for the user's preferences and enhances their overall experience. It's about creating an environment where users feel in control and not dictated to.

Diving Deeper into Automatic File Downloads

Let's zoom in specifically on automatic file downloads. This is an area that often raises eyebrows, and for good reason. The idea of files being automatically downloaded to your device can sound risky. So, it's important to understand the use cases and the potential implications. Automatic downloads, when not properly managed, can open the door to security vulnerabilities. Imagine a malicious file being silently downloaded and executed—that's a scary thought! Therefore, any system that uses automatic downloads needs to have robust security measures in place. Think of it like having a high-security vault; if you're going to store valuable items (in this case, your data and system integrity), you need to make sure the vault is impenetrable. Proper security protocols, such as file scanning and verification, are essential to mitigate these risks.

Legitimate Use Cases for Automatic Downloads

Despite the potential risks, there are legitimate reasons why automatic file downloads might be necessary. Consider software updates. Many applications automatically download updates in the background to ensure you're always running the latest version. This helps to protect you from vulnerabilities and ensures you have access to the newest features. Another example is media downloads. If you're using a service that allows you to download music or videos, automatic downloads can streamline the process, making it more convenient. However, the key here is user consent and awareness. Users should be informed when a download is happening and have the ability to manage these downloads. It's like ordering food online; you expect to know what you're getting and when it will arrive.

Transparency and Communication are Key

When it comes to automatic file downloads, transparency is absolutely crucial. Users need to know why these downloads are happening, what files are being downloaded, and where they are being stored. Clear communication can help alleviate concerns and build trust. Think of it as having a friendly chat with your doctor; they explain why they're prescribing a certain medication and what the potential side effects might be. Similarly, developers need to communicate the rationale behind automatic downloads in a clear and understandable way. This includes providing detailed information about security measures and how user data is protected. Open communication fosters trust and helps users feel more comfortable with the process.

The Importance of User Choice and Control

Circling back to our main point, the ability to disable popup and automatic download settings is paramount. User choice and control are foundational principles of a positive user experience. When users feel they have control over their environment, they are more likely to trust and engage with a system. Forcibly enabling settings takes away that control and can create a sense of unease. It's like being in a car where you can't adjust the seat or the mirrors—you're going to feel uncomfortable and out of control. Providing options and settings allows users to tailor their experience to their needs and preferences. This not only enhances user satisfaction but also promotes a sense of ownership and responsibility.

Building Trust Through Options

Offering the option to disable popups and automatic downloads isn't just about convenience; it's about building trust. When developers respect user choices, they demonstrate that they value user autonomy and privacy. This trust is essential for long-term engagement and loyalty. Think of it as a friendship; if you consistently respect your friend's boundaries and choices, they are more likely to trust and respect you in return. Similarly, in the digital world, respecting user choices fosters a positive relationship between users and developers. This trust can lead to increased adoption, positive feedback, and a stronger community.

Balancing Functionality with User Experience

Of course, there's a balance to be struck between functionality and user experience. Some features might genuinely benefit from automatic downloads or popups, but it's crucial to implement these features in a way that doesn't compromise user control. This means providing clear explanations, offering options, and ensuring transparency at every step. It's like designing a new gadget; you want it to be functional, but you also want it to be user-friendly and intuitive. The same principle applies to software and applications. By carefully considering the user experience and prioritizing user control, developers can create systems that are both effective and enjoyable to use.

Addressing the Specific Questions

Now, let’s address the specific questions raised at the beginning of this discussion. Why were popup and automatic download settings forcibly enabled, and why can't they be disabled? What is the necessity for automatic file downloads to client devices? These are important questions, and the answers should be clear and straightforward.

Why Were These Settings Forcibly Enabled?

The reasons for forcibly enabling these settings can vary. It could be for communication purposes, to ensure users receive important updates or announcements. It could also be related to functionality, where certain features require these settings to be enabled. However, the key takeaway is that the rationale should be communicated clearly to the users. Without clear communication, it’s easy to feel like your autonomy is being disregarded. Transparency is the bridge that connects functionality with user trust.

Why Can't They Be Disabled?

If these settings cannot be disabled, it's essential to understand the technical constraints or reasons behind this decision. Sometimes, disabling certain features might break core functionality, or there might be security considerations that prevent disabling them. However, this doesn't negate the importance of user choice. If disabling the settings is not an option, then clear explanations and alternative solutions should be provided. It’s like being told you can't take a certain route to your destination; you'd want to know why and what alternative routes are available.

What Is the Necessity for Automatic File Downloads?

The necessity for automatic file downloads should be clearly justified. As we've discussed, there are legitimate use cases, such as software updates or media downloads. However, the benefits must outweigh the potential risks and concerns. Users need to understand why these downloads are necessary and what security measures are in place to protect their devices. It’s similar to understanding why a construction project is happening in your neighborhood; you want to know the benefits it will bring and how it will impact your daily life.

Conclusion: Prioritizing User Trust and Control

In conclusion, the discussion around popup and automatic download permissions highlights the critical importance of user trust and control. While there may be legitimate reasons for enabling these settings, transparency, communication, and user choice should always be prioritized. Forcibly enabling settings without clear explanations can erode trust and create a negative user experience. By offering options, providing clear justifications, and ensuring robust security measures, developers can create systems that are both functional and user-friendly.

Ultimately, it’s about striking a balance between functionality and user empowerment. When users feel in control and well-informed, they are more likely to trust and engage with the system. So, let's keep the conversation going and continue to advocate for user-centric design and transparency in the digital world. What are your thoughts on this topic? Share your experiences and perspectives in the comments below!